Bust dollars were NEVER minted in a collar to produce reeding, so you just sold an outright fake coin. It is obvious that the "Chucky Cheese token" in your auction has reeding. And, no, you do not have some rare variety that was made by accident. I think that you are fully aware of what you did

I have a suggestion, for coins I feel refunds should be extended up to 30 days not 7 days. People in order to authenticate coins have to send them in for grading / authentication with pcgs or ngc or other reputeable grading companies. 7 days is just not enough in my opinion.
